Question for my VJ family , does anyone have a rough idea about how long it takes from receiving Noa 2 approval to interview!

It’s really hard to estimate because past cases often made it to interview a lot faster than most recent cases. I used to rely on those cases to understand my own timeline, but things really started to get delayed for May filers. 

 

To use mine as a timeline, I received NOA2 on a October 26th, it arrived at my consulate today, December 20th. So approximately 2 months to consulate and then not sure how far out my interview will be, but I’m assuming late January to mid-February. So, it’s seemingly like 3-4 months from NOA2 to interview, at least for me.
